Natural Gas Futures: No Changes To The Consolidation Theme

Prices of natural gas started the new trading week within the broad consolidative phase in place since mid-March.

Considering advanced prints from CME Group for natural gas futures markets, open interest rose further on Monday, this time by nearly 11K contracts. In the same direction, volume increased for the second session in a row, now by around 67.3K contracts.
 

Natural Gas: Support remains below the $2.00 mark

Prices of natural gas started the new trading week within the broad consolidative phase in place since mid-March. Monday’s price action was on the back of increasing open interest and volume and exposes further range bound for the time being. On the downside, the next support remains in the sub-$2.00 mark per MMBtu (February 22).
